diff options
author | Ned Batchelder <ned@nedbatchelder.com> | 2020-01-04 16:02:29 -0500 |
---|---|---|
committer | Ned Batchelder <ned@nedbatchelder.com> | 2020-01-04 16:07:52 -0500 |
commit | aefe08b437d1ce9c4e0bbdd7dba69e7316ede313 (patch) | |
tree | 81c0c0d86f7d5f8bcb6edf13a8f68047c11f3cee /coverage/control.py | |
parent | acf063cfff09d26678709ce6894d605f4199db09 (diff) | |
download | python-coveragepy-git-aefe08b437d1ce9c4e0bbdd7dba69e7316ede313.tar.gz |
Ensure file touching happens if nothing was measured. #884
Diffstat (limited to 'coverage/control.py')
-rw-r--r-- | coverage/control.py |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/coverage/control.py b/coverage/control.py index 3a0b0107..e8d4bc95 100644 --- a/coverage/control.py +++ b/coverage/control.py @@ -716,7 +716,7 @@ class Coverage(object): # Touch all the files that could have executed, so that we can # mark completely unexecuted files as 0% covered. - if self._data: + if self._data is not None: for file_path, plugin_name in self._inorout.find_possibly_unexecuted_files(): file_path = self._file_mapper(file_path) self._data.touch_file(file_path, plugin_name) |